Kinds Of Sedation Options
When it comes to selecting the appropriate sedation choice for your oral procedure, you'll discover several approaches customized to different needs and preferences. One of the most typical kinds are laughing gas, oral sedation, and IV sedation.
Nitrous oxide, also referred to as giggling gas, is a popular option for numerous people. It's inhaled with a mask, offering a soothing impact while permitting you to remain conscious and receptive. The effects diminish swiftly, so you can drive yourself home later.
Dental sedation entails taking a recommended drug before your visit. This option can vary from moderate to modest sedation, relying on the dosage. You'll feel kicked back, however you may not bear in mind much of the procedure. You'll require somebody to accompany you home, as the results can remain.
IV sedation provides deeper relaxation and allows your dental expert to adjust the sedation level during the procedure. Preparing for Your Visit
Planning for your oral visit entails a couple of necessary steps to make certain a smooth experience. First, validate your appointment time and day. It is essential to get here in a timely manner to prevent any type of hold-ups.
Next, review any medicines you're currently taking with your dental practitioner ahead of time. This includes over-the-counter medicines and supplements, as they may impact your sedation alternatives.
If you're having sedation dental care, your dentist will likely provide particular guidelines. You may require to refrain from consuming or drinking for a specific period before your appointment. Follow these standards carefully to ensure your safety and security.
